With the increasing integration of AI in vehicles, how do you envision the future of automotive accessibility for people with disabilities? What innovative features or adaptations could be developed to enhance their driving or passenger experience, and what challenges might need to be addressed to ensure inclusivity and safety for all?
The integration of AI in vehicles holds immense potential for enhancing automotive accessibility, particularly for individuals with disabilities. Here are some innovative features and adaptations that could significantly improve their driving and passenger experience:
Innovative Features
- Adaptive Driving Controls: AI can tailor driving controls based on user needs, such as adjusting pedal height or steering sensitivity to accommodate different physical capabilities.
- Voice Recognition and Assistants: Advanced voice-activated systems can allow drivers to control navigation, climate, and entertainment without needing to use their hands, making driving safer and more accessible.
- Real-Time Environmental Adaptation: AI can analyze real-time traffic and weather conditions, adjusting routes and driving methods accordingly to enhance safety.
- Personalized Vehicle Settings: The vehicle can learn and remember individual preferences for seat positioning, mirror adjustments, and climate settings, making it easier for users to enter and exit the vehicle comfortably.
Challenges to Address
- Regulatory and Safety Standards: Ensuring that AI-driven adaptations meet safety regulations for both drivers and passengers with disabilities is crucial. Collaboration with regulatory bodies will be essential.
- Technical Limitations: Current technology may have limitations in understanding diverse user needs. Input from the disability community during the design phase can help address this.
- Public Acceptance and Awareness: Educating the general public about these advancements will also play a key role in fostering an inclusive environment ensuring that all users feel safe and confident on the road.
